Benefits of Point of Sale (POS) System for all Businesses

Improved Accuracy and Reduced Human Errors

First things first, setting up a POS system for your business means easy price calculations and inventory tracking. Unlike humans, computers don’t usually make mistakes. So, this reduces the chances of human errors that can occur when using manual methods. 

There will be fewer errors all across the board from pricing, and financial reporting to inventory management. This also means that when applying discounts, promotions or taxes, the prices will be automatically adjusted. The result is minimum human error and a happier customer. Centralised Data Management

A POS system serves as a central hub for all your data. As it manages various aspects of the business, including sales, inventory, customer data, and reporting. This also makes it easier to access and analyse critical information. 

With centralised data management, you can create custom reports with all your KPIs to understand the performance of your business. These insightful reports also allow you to make informed decisions towards the greater success of your business.

Compliance with Tax Regulations

As mentioned above, with all the data in a central system, you can generate accurate sales and tax reports. You can also make sure that your business is compliant with all the state or country regulations. This simplifies the tax filing process and ensures you don’t run into any tax-related complications in the future. 

Accurate Inventory Management

Accurate inventory management is one of the main advantages of a POS system for businesses. It provides real-time inventory tracking, allowing businesses to keep an accurate record of their stock levels. Advanced systems also send notifications to your phone alerting you about your stock levels. 

This helps in preventing stockouts and enables businesses to make informed purchasing decisions based on sales data and inventory trends. This is especially helpful for grocery stores or florists where improper stock management can lead to spoilage and loss. Having a proper grocery store POS or floral POS will keep you updated on the stock levels. 

Scalability and Customizability

A traditional cash counter has limited customizability and cannot accommodate your growing business. But a cloud-based POS system is designed to accommodate the needs of businesses of all sizes. 

They can be easily scaled as the business grows, accommodating additional registers or locations. Furthermore, many POS systems offer customizable features and integrations, allowing businesses to tailor the system to their specific requirements.

Efficient Employee Management

Today POS systems come with an HR or Employee management feature that could be quite handy for small businesses. This feature allows you to track employee working schedules and commissions. 

For a small business with no human resource manager, this feature adds a lot of value. This helps businesses manage their workforce more effectively, track employee performance, and calculate payroll accurately.

Integrated Loyalty Programs

Another neat benefit of the POS system is that it offers an integrated loyalty program. With this feature, you can offer your regular customers rewards and discounts and even encourage new customers to shop frequently. 

This can include features such as points accumulation, discounts, or special promotions. This not only encourages customer retention but also provides valuable data for marketing campaigns.

Integrated Marketing Capabilities

Some POS systems also offer marketing features such as email marketing integration, customer segmentation, and targeted promotions. These types of marketing features enable businesses to promote their products and features and reach their targeted audience with ease. You get to easily engage with customers and drive sales. Enhanced Customer Experience

There are multiple ways a point-of-sale system can enhance the experience of your customers. Your customers won’t have to wait in long queues thanks to quick and seamless transactions. POS systems also offer multiple payment options so they can pay in their preferred method of payment. 

Since all the transactions and purchase history are available in your database, you can offer personalised services to your customers. For instance, if a regular customer always buys a gallon of milk, give a discount on a packet of bread. This type of personalised service induces contentment in your customers encouraging them to keep shopping with you.

Efficient Returns and Exchanges

Finally, if your customer wants to return or exchange something and your business policy allows it, then with POS you can! Unlike a handwritten register where you’d have to unprofessionally cross out previous entries and make separate memos.

A POS system automatically adjusts inventory levels and processes refunds or exchanges smoothly. This makes the process of returns and exchanges pretty simple and easy for both you and your customers.
